Scaffolding Components

NEVER use damaged scaffolding components.

When dismantling NEVER drop scaffolding components from heights. As well as damaging the components it may cause injury or even death to persons below.

Never mix scaffolding components that are not designed to be compatible.

To find out the load capacity for scaffolding components check with the manufacturer.

A clamp connector is used to join two scaffolding components together rapidly and securely.

It’s a good idea to store scaffolding components as close as possible to the work area; this will reduce distances over which loads have to be manually moved.

Make sure that all selected scaffolding components are constructed to the requirements of the ANSI and ASTM.

Handy hint: Leave a section of scaffolding platform open to enable the lowering of boards and other scaffolding components between levels.

Scaffolding is constructed from a variety of frames, poles, beams and brackets which to help support the structure making it very sturdy.
